在选择图形编程工具时,需要根据具体的应用场景来进行决策。如果是开发游戏,Unity 和 Unreal Engine 通常是。Unity 因其跨平台性和丰富的资源,适用于各种类型的游戏开发,无论是 2D 还是 3D 游戏。Unreal Engine 则在图形渲染和视觉效果方面表现出色,适合对画面质量要求较高的大型游戏。
初学者适合的图形编程工具
对于初学者而言,以下几款图形编程工具是较为适合的。Scratch 是一个非常不错的选择,它采用了直观的拖拽式编程界面,用户通过简单地拖拽代码块就能创建动画、故事和游戏。Scratch 的内容丰富多样,有大量的示例和教程可供学习,而且其社区活跃,初学者可以分享作品、获取灵感和交流经验。
活跃的图形编程开发社区的特点
活跃的图形编程开发社区通常具有以下几个显著特点。首先,拥有丰富的资源共享。成员们积极分享自己的项目代码、教程、插件等,为其他开发者提供了宝贵的学习和借鉴材料。例如,在一些知名的图形编程社区中,经常可以看到高质量的开源项目,涵盖了从简单的图形效果演示到复杂的游戏开发框架。其次,交流互动频繁。开发者们在社区中积极提问、解答问题,分享经验和技巧。这种互动不仅能够帮助新手快速成长,也能让有经验的开发者不断拓展知识边界。
咨询详情
例如,针对某个特定的图形编程难题,社区成员会纷纷发表自己的见解和解决方案,形成热烈的讨论氛围。再者,社区通常会组织各种活动和竞赛,激发开发者的创新能力和竞争意识。例如,举办图形编程创意大赛,鼓励开发者展示自己独特的作品,推动图形编程技术的应用和发展。另外,活跃的社区还会及时跟进和更新技术动态。当新的图形编程技术、工具或框架出现时,社区成员会迅速进行研究和分享,使得整个社区始终保持在技术前沿。
咨询详情
一级图形化编程考级究竟包含哪些内容?
一级图形化编程考级是一项对学生在图形化编程领域的技术能力进行评估的考试。以下是一级考级可能包含的内容:
跨平台图形编程工具的优势
跨平台图形编程工具具有诸多显著优势。首先,其**的优点在于能够让开发者的作品在多种不同的操作系统和设备上运行,无需为每个平台进行单独的开发和优化,大大节省了时间和成本。例如,一款使用跨平台工具开发的游戏,可以轻松地在 Windows、Mac、Linux 等桌面系统以及 iOS、Android 等移动设备上发布,覆盖更广泛的用户群体。